
The Granada Science Park is a 70,000 square meter interactive museum complex dedicated to physics, chemistry, and biology, featuring exhibits on the universe, biosphere, light, robotics, and a 50-meter observation tower overlooking the city and the Alhambra. Visitors can explore permanent exhibits and specialized rooms including the BioDome with over 200 animal and plant species, a 360-degree planetarium with 7,000 recreated stars, and a Tropical Butterfly Garden.
